Speaking is used as a gerund, which is a verb masquerading as a noun that is useful in naming rather than expressing actions. However, the British people lean more toward using to, whereas with is more prevalent in American English. "To look forward to" is a transitive phrasal verb with an idiomatic connotation that suggests feelings of excitement toward an upcoming event or activity. Gerunds are used to create nouns from verbs so they can be utilized as subjects or objects in sentences. We use talk when there is a listener who understands what is said and often when both people in the conversation do some speaking.
